Klokbouw Building Exhibition

A walk up and down 5 floors at Klokebouw Building during the last Dutch Design Week in Eindhoven, through the multidisciplinary of the showed works.

Shapeways gives designers the chance to produce their own products and sell these worldwide. This is the case of 36 pencil bowl by Michiel Cornelissen, hal 2.
The magnetic technology of Levitating Lamp by LOS!Series, hal 2.
At "experience your creativity" stand visitors could interact with the new and unique furniture pieces from Arpa and the inspiring façade solutions from Trespa, hal 3.
The lamp part of the Reading Furnitures collection by Remy Van Oers, hal 4.
Ausgebrannt by Kaspar Hamacher: a series of low stools and tables made from tree trunks which have been formed by use of fire, hal 2.
